# GE range error code FF

### What FF means, in the maker’s own words

The electronic control needs to be replaced. Note the collision: FF on a refrigerator means the freezer is warming and the food is at risk, which is an entirely different situation on an entirely different appliance.

### Where this code actually appears

On the control panel, and usually with a sound. GE describes their refrigerator codes as flashing green on the display and typically accompanied by a beeping, and the range, microwave and dishwasher tables all describe codes you can read from the front of the appliance. That is the opposite of some makes, where the number is written into a hidden log and never shown — here, if something is wrong, the appliance generally tells you. Photograph what it says before cutting the power, because a reset erases it and the code is most of the diagnosis.

### What to do about it

- Confirm which appliance is showing it. FF on a range and FF on a refrigerator have nothing to do with each other.
- Power down at the breaker for a minute and restore.
- Have the inputs measured before the control is ordered, as for F5 and F8.
- Check the appliance’s age from the date code before committing to a board.
